Final Cut express is very adequate even if you are relatively
experienced editor. I believe it can even support HD editing and
timecode (not 100% sure about the timecode). I used to use the older
version of express and was very happy with it. It is simply final cut
pro with fewer non essential features (especially for unicycle videos)
and somewhat less rendering capabilities and realtime playback. For
the money express is a great buy. You can get it for super cheap if
you buy it preloaded on a new mac .
